BAJAN SUN MAGAZINE DEC 2014 Christmas Seduction T he kitchen was filled with a mixture of aromas guaranteed to satisfy the olfactory system and please the stomach. The menu was simple but it yelled Christmas quite loudly. Jug-jug, baked turkey, roasted pork, a honey glazed ham complete with pineapple and cherries ,green peas and rice, tossed salad, steamed veggies and AJ’s favorite; sweet potato pie. On the dining room table was an artful display of golden apples and cinnamon sticks. The scent of Christmas was rich, masking her fear of his reaction. This was the home of Sade Hope, beautiful single writer who at this time was a nervous wreck. She was planning a special surprise for her boyfriend AJ but the thing was to get him there. She concocted a story about wanting holes drilled so she could install new curtains in the living room, the true gentleman he is, he obliged.
